ON DEPRESSION

Contributed by Lionel on Tuesday, 17th February 2004 @ 02:08:06 PM in AEST
Topic: happypoetry



Be depressed? Who - Me?
Too much to see,
too much to do,
before I'm through.

God's world's so bright,
Even shines at night.
I feel joy too,
when I see you.

I also love seeing,
happy children playing.
Isn't all nature too,
wonderful thru and thru.

Even working is fun,
when the jobs nicely done.
We're blessed, understand,
living in this land.

I'm even happy knowing,
Fiery trials inhance growing.
Elated also that I am,
held safely in God's hand.

Pleasure results, you know,
from helping others,--- so,
depression can't hinder me,
there's too much to see.

There's too much to do,
why let it hinder you?
Because, with Christ finally,
We'll live in ecstasy.

Rom.8:28 " and we know that all things work
together for good to them that love God...."

Lionel
